NARRATIVE OF INCIDENT:
Retail theft is a growing threat for retailers, customers, and communities around the state. During the week of November 13th, 2023, members of the Springfield Police Department worked with loss prevention personnel from the Springfield Target store on Gateway Street to run a mission specifically addressing retail theft. During a four-hour period, six people were arrested for stealing various items including electronics, clothing, and housewares. None of the people arrested made any attempt to pay for the items they had taken from inside the store.

Most of the individuals were cited to appear in the Springfield Municipal Court to be held accountable for their actions. One of the people arrested for theft also had outstanding arrest warrants and was taken into custody without incident.

Additionally, SPD personnel contacted an individual believed to be selling stolen merchandise. The individual was found to be in possession of multiple pieces of construction equipment from a local hardware store and had multiple warrants for their arrest.

This is the third retail theft mission SPD has engaged in recently and more are planned for the near future.
